Lola | MirrorLog Lola MirrorLog.com watermark 2 months ago

There is over 500,000 pounds (227,000 kilograms) of man-made trash and debris on the moon, including 96 bags of urine, feces, and vomit.

There is over 500,000 pounds (227,000 kilograms) of man-made trash and debris on the moon, including 96 bags of urine, feces, and vomit. | MirrorLog

Login to join this discussion

Login MirrorLog Signup with google Signup With Google Register
23 views
Use voice

Post comment

0 comments Follow creator